TL;DR: Electric vehicles are significantly cleaner than gas cars over their entire lifecycle, even when charged using fossil fuel-heavy grids. The manufacturing carbon debt of an EV is typically offset within one to two years of driving, after which it becomes cleaner than every subsequent mile driven by an internal combustion engine vehicle.

The Lifecycle Reality Check

The debate surrounding electric vehicle (EV) emissions often ignores the concept of lifecycle analysis. While battery production requires significant energy, resulting in higher initial carbon emissions, the operational phase tells a different story. As the electrical grid becomes greener, the environmental impact of charging an EV decreases. In contrast, gas cars continue to emit pollutants directly from the tailpipe for their entire existence. Market analysis indicates that the total cost of ownership for EVs is dropping rapidly, driven by falling battery prices and improved efficiency. This economic shift accelerates adoption, further reducing the overall carbon footprint of the transportation sector.

Strategic Implications for Automakers

Automakers must adopt a dual-strategy approach. First, they need to invest in sustainable supply chains, particularly for lithium and cobalt sourcing. Second, they must prioritize battery recycling technologies to create a circular economy. Strategic partnerships with renewable energy providers can also enhance brand value and reduce the perceived “dirtiness” of EVs. Companies that fail to address these supply chain issues risk facing regulatory penalties and consumer backlash. The transition is not just technological but also logistical and ethical.

Case Study: The Nordic Model

Scandinavian countries provide a compelling case study. With hydroelectric and wind power dominating their grids, EVs in these regions have a near-zero operational carbon footprint. Studies show that even in regions with coal-heavy grids, EVs outperform gas cars within two years of use. This data supports the argument that the infrastructure of energy production is just as critical as the vehicle itself. Policy makers must incentivize grid decarbonization alongside EV adoption to maximize environmental benefits.

FAQ

Q: Do EVs produce more pollution during manufacturing?
A: Yes, initially, but they offset this within two years of driving.

Q: Does coal power make EVs dirty?
A: No, they remain cleaner than gas cars even on coal-heavy grids.

Q: Will recycling batteries solve the resource crisis?
A: Recycling will significantly reduce the need for new mining and lower emissions.
